Translates well to DS [Posted on 2008-10-06] Many years ago I played this game on Nintendo 64. When I bought myself a Nintendo DS as a treat, I was happily surprised to learn that they had made an edition of Mario Party for it. And also to my surprise, the game translated beautifully from console to hand-held.
Good:
-Graphics are unbelievably clear and liquid.
-Frequent auto-saves ensure you won't lose your place.
-Mini-games are FUN, I have come across some old favorites.
-Numerous ways to play; from the classic board-game setup to new individual 'puzzle games'.
-Lots of bang for your buck, you won't get bored easily.
Bad:
-One level was incredibly hard to beat and I couldn't go on to the next board game until it was cleared; though I realize this is an issue of skill, it took months!
-I'm on the last board and there are a few of the old mini games that I loved that have yet to appear. Hopefully they just aren't unlocked yet! There's gotta be Hot-Rope-Jump, right?
